  • Patent number: 7560653
    Abstract: An improved electrical switch nut and boot seal assembly is provided having a stainless steel or aluminum nut and flexible boot to provide an exemplary fluid seal between an electrical switch and the electrical switch nut and boot seal device. The electrical switch may be a toggle switch or push button type circuit breaker or any other type electrical switch device where the advantages of the present invention make themselves useful such as may exist on any control panel of a recreational vehicle (i.e., boat, snowmobile, or other type land or water craft). A key feature of the invention is that the nut and flexible boot are separate pieces that can be mixed and matched to change the outer shape and/or colors of the various nuts and/or flexible boots. The fluid and moisture seal is provided by capturing a flange of the flexible boot between various inner surfaces of the nut and electrical switch.

  • Patent number: 7294800
    Abstract: A switching device capable of preventing entrance of water from outside of a case through a space below an operation knob into the case is disclosed. The switching device includes: a switch; a case within which the switch is accommodated; a hollow cylinder which is formed integrally with the upper surface of the case and open to above and below to communicate with the inside of the case; an operation knob provided to cover an upper opening of the cylinder such that the operation knob can swing; and an operation bar which extends through a lower opening of the cylinder into the case to transmit the motion of the operation knob to the switch. A concave is formed on the upper surface of the case at a position around the cylinder. A lid for covering a part of the concave is provided on the concave near the cylinder.

  • Patent number: 6818845
    Abstract: The switching element (1) of the switch per this invention is closely enveloped, at least in the area of its free end, by an elastic diaphragm (5) which also encloses, at a distance, the contact surfaces (2) facing the switching element (1) and which is tightly connected to the switch housing (4; 6). This tightly seals the contact region against the external environment of the switch and thus reliably prevents contamination and oxidation of the contact surfaces. As another advantageous feature, the number of switch components is thus reduced, a mechanical spring is not needed for retaining the switching element (1) in its engaged position, and the design permits miniaturization.

  • Patent number: 6710273
    Abstract: A toggle switch has a switch cover, a toggle lever, and a one piece pre-molded seal. The switch cover has an opening, and the toggle lever extends through the opening into the switch cover. A neck of the one piece pre-molded seal surrounds the toggle lever and provides sealing between the toggle lever and the switch cover. The one piece pre-molded seal also may have a planar portion that provides sealing at an interface between the switch case and the switch cover.

  • Patent number: 6380500
    Abstract: The invention includes a switch and sealing arrangement that provides positive sealing and is easy to assemble. The invention includes a switch housing having an upper compartment that is in communication with an exterior of the switch housing and has drainage slots therein. The upper compartment is separated from a lower compartment by an inner base in which a cylindrical barrel extends upwardly from the inner base. The lower compartment of the switch housing receives an electrical contact switch therein that is controlled by an actuator lever that is in contact with a post extending through the cylindrical barrel from a rocker button. A seal is provided that has an outer lip and an inner opening and is mounted on the upwardly extending cylindrical barrel such that the outer lip engages an outer surface of the cylindrical barrel. The post of the rocker button fits into the inner opening of the seal and seals the lower compartment from upper compartment when the rocker button is engaged to the switch housing.
